Ancient Chamori Royal Wedding
"The Love Beads Ritual"
The Maga'saina orders the Låhi to remove his Love Beads or
Bangat Guinaiya. He turns to the Palåo'an and installs the Love Beads or Bangat Guinaiya
on the Palåo'an's right wrist. This is the universal sign that the Palåo'an and the
Låhi are now spoken for. The Ancient Chamori term for this ritual is
"maapengga".
The ancient people of Guahan or
Taotaomo'nas believed in the sacred and heavenly union between a woman and a man. They
called the Ancient Chamori Royal Wedding Ceremony "Hacha'gua", which means to be
ONE or to become ONE.
As one of the only surviving matriarchal societies in the world, the Taotao Tano' of
Guahan capture the true meaning and symbolism of ancient class royalty and womanhood in
the perpetuation of their unique wedding system..."Hacha'gua"
